Karina G. Zecchin is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cancer Research and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Karina G. Zecchin has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Molecular Biology, 12 papers in Cancer Research and 10 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Karina G. Zecchin’s work include Cancer, Lipids, and Metabolism (9 papers), Peroxisome Proliferator-Activated Receptors (7 papers) and Cholangiocarcinoma and Gallbladder Cancer Studies (6 papers). Karina G. Zecchin is often cited by papers focused on Cancer, Lipids, and Metabolism (9 papers), Peroxisome Proliferator-Activated Receptors (7 papers) and Cholangiocarcinoma and Gallbladder Cancer Studies (6 papers). Karina G. Zecchin collaborates with scholars based in Brazil, United States and Colombia. Karina G. Zecchin's co-authors include Edgard Graner, Ricardo D. Coletta, Michelle Agostini, Débora Campanella Bastos, Fabiana Seguin, Helena C.F. Oliveira, Luiz Paulo Kowalski, Anı́bal E. Vercesi, Sabrina Daniela da Silva and Márcio Ajudarte Lopes and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Diabetes and Free Radical Biology and Medicine.
